Youth Camp Leaders

Young women who are ages 16 and 17 may serve as youth camp leaders. Their responsibilities should be meaningful and appropriate for their experience, skills, and training. Serving others will help them build leadership skills and strengthen their testimonies. Youth camp leaders should:

  • Receive leadership training prior to camp.
  • Provide a positive example for younger girls.
  • Serve as teachers and trainers at camp.
  • Help include everyone.
  • Help evaluate camp.

The Young Women Camp Manual contains ideas for youth camp leader assignments and responsibilities.
